Syracuse football makes top 7 of 4-star WR Messiah Hampton, Oregon has analyst buzz
Word broke on Sunday that fast-rising Rochester, N.Y., product Messiah Hampton, the No. 1 prospect within his cycle in New York state, has trimmed his list of contenders still in the running to seven suitors, and Syracuse football remains in contention.
The elite four-star wide receiver in the 2026 class has a final seven of the Orange, Oregon, Penn State, Ohio State, Michigan, Georgia and fellow Atlantic Coast Conference school Miami. That's some kind of top seven, and it's great to see the 'Cuse in the mix.
That being said, over at On3, there are at least three analyst projections in the direction of Oregon for Hampton. On Sunday, I didn't see any predictions for him on the 247Sports Web site or .

According to media reports, the 6-foot-1, 191-pound Hampton plans to make his college decision known on June 13, which is fast approaching.
